Output 189983b04aa3daf5d4ae4e5b8531a3c678b290bb48dbea18d13a7a2d44020d28:7

value
43412502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ca4a161f8aaf5f4c32afe6268f54e54cd1958947 OP_EQUAL
address
MSLmUo38ft6MKJdZgXkrTM25cX16T7BBFi
transaction
189983b04aa3daf5d4ae4e5b8531a3c678b290bb48dbea18d13a7a2d44020d28
spent
true